Output Voltage (VOUT) of Setting Structure of Upper Figure
It is noted as Volume 1 Output Voltage = V1, Loudness Filter Output Voltage = V2, VOUT and Gv (Boost quantity) is
given at the lower formula
VOUT = V1 + V2 (Vrms)
(V1 + V2)
Gv = 20 log
– (Volume 1 attenuation quantity) (dB)
VIN
ex.) VIN = 1 Vrms/60 Hz, Volume1 = –30 dB,
Output Volutage and Boost Quantity of 60 Hz of Loudness Volume = –20 dB setting
From: Volume1, Loudness Volume attenuation quantity
Become: V1 = 31.6 mVrms
V2 = 100 mVrms
If the sub situdes the equation for the upper formula,
the following equation is given,
Gv
Volume 1 = –30 dB
VOUT = 31.6 m + 100 m
= 131.6 mVrms
Frequency (Hz)
(31.6 m + 100 m)
Gv = 20 log
– (–30 dB)
1
=12.4 dB is obtained
